The cheapest way to get from Derby to Overseal is to line 2 bus which costs £1 - £3 and takes 1h 53m.
The fastest way to get from Derby to Overseal is to taxi which takes 27 min and costs £40 - £50.
No, there is no direct bus from Derby to Overseal. However, there are services departing from Victoria Street and arriving at Robin Hood via New Street.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 1h 33m.
The distance between Derby and Overseal is 19 miles. The road distance is 17.4 miles.
The best way to get from Derby to Overseal without a car is to train and line 21 bus which takes 57 min and costs .
It takes approximately 57 min to get from Derby to Overseal, including transfers.
Derby to Overseal bus services, operated by Trent Barton, depart from Victoria Street station.
Derby to Overseal bus services, operated by Trent Barton, arrive at Market Place station.
Yes, the driving distance between Derby to Overseal is 17 miles. It takes approximately 27 min to drive from Derby to Overseal.
